Closing the gap between dreams and reality, Fabio Salerno's films are the missing link between Dario Argento and George & Mike Kuchar. THE OTHER DIMENSION AND THE FILMS OF FABIO SALERNO is a 2-disc set that presents the late Salerno's complete filmography for the first time in North America. From the accomplished anthology THE OTHER DIMENSION to the fan-favorite short ARPIE, these D.I.Y. arthouse horror films from Italy are true discoveries for adventurous horrorheads.

directed by: Fabio Salerno
starring: Various
1981-1992 / 441 min (combined) / 1.33:1 / Italian DTS-HD MA 2.0

Additional info:

  • Region Free 2-disc Blu-ray
  • English subtitles

DISC 1: THE FEATURES

  • Preserved from the only 16mm film elements in existence
  • Italian language with newly created English subtitles
  • THE OTHER DIMENSION (1992, 78 mins)
  • DEEP NIGHT (1991, 69 mins)
  • FABIO: A 48-minute documentary by Oblivion Films
  • The Making of DEEP NIGHT: A 69-minute archival documentary
  • Photo gallery

DISC 2: THE SHORTS

  • Preserved from the best available VHS & digital masters, as film elements are lost
  • Italian language with newly created English subtitles, or partial English subtitles due to audio elements
  • ARPIE (1987)
  • OLTRETOMBA (1987)
  • MEZZANOTTE (1986)
  • EXTRA SENSORIA (1985)
  • TRE SAGOME IN NERO (1985)
  • VAMPIRI (1985)
  • INCUBO (1984)
  • NOTTE (1983)
  • CADAVERI (1982)
  • LA PAURA ESISTE GIÀ (UN NATALE ROSSO SANGUE) (1981)
  • MAGIC (1981)
  • LA SIGNORA DEL 5 PIANO (1981)
  • The Making of OLTRETOMBA: A 12-minute archival documentary
  • MAGIC: Commentary by Bleeding Skull’s Joseph A. Ziemba
